About The CPC
Working from the premise that one of the main reasons children are neglected and abused is because parents lack the proper parenting skills, the center works to alleviate this problem by offering counseling and educational services to parents, and support services to children.

CPC Mission
To prevent child abuse and neglect in the Northern Shenandoah Valley

CPC Mission
To prevent child abuse & neglect in the Northern Shenandoah Valley through the use of professionals & trained volunteers to provide direct service to high risk (at risk of abuse & neglect of children) families in order to improve the quality of family life.
